What Is Morning Sickness & Its Impact?
Causes Behind Pregnancy Nausea
Morning sickness—though a misleading name, as it can occur anytime—is linked to hormonal surges in early pregnancy, especially rising hCG, estrogen, and progesterone. These changes affect the digestive system and brain’s “vomiting center,” triggering nausea and vomiting.
Common Symptoms & Daily Disruption
Nausea, occasional vomiting, sensitivity to smells, and food aversions can begin early and last varying durations. Even mild symptoms can disrupt day-to-day life, nutrition intake, energy, and emotional well-being—leaving mothers feeling physically drained and stressed.

Natural Therapies to Reduce Nausea
Ginger, Peppermint & Herbal Teas
-
Ginger is supported by numerous studies for reducing nausea; fresh or capsule form works.
-
Peppermint tea soothes gastric muscles and calms nerves.
-
Chamomile and lemon balm can ease upset stomach and anxiety.
Acupressure and Essential Oils
-
The P6 (Neiguan) wrist point—pressed with a wristband or fingers—has been shown to reduce nausea.
-
Inhaled lemon or ginger essential oils provide aromatherapy relief via brushing or diffuser.
Diet Modifications & Supplement Support
-
Eat frequent, small, bland meals: crackers, rice cakes, soups.
-
Use smoothies with ginger and banana.
-
Prevent low blood sugar with protein and complex carbs between meals.
-
Supplement with vitamin B6, magnesium, and a prenatal multivitamin.
Hydration Strategies & Electrolytes
-
Sip fluids frequently with flavored or coconut water to maintain electrolyte balance.
-
Ice chips or popsicles offer discreet relief.
-
Failing to hydrate can worsen nausea and lower energy.

When to Seek Additional Help
Warning Signs That Need Medical Review
-
Persistent vomiting (hyperemesis gravidarum)
-
Severe weight loss or dehydration
-
Inability to keep liquids down
These require medical attention, possibly with intravenous fluids or prescribed medications.
